# Env file — Cartwheel dispatch, driver-assignment heuristic
# Scope: staging only. Do not promote to prod.
# The heuristic weights (proximity, shift balance, refusal rate) are tuned
# for the Velmont pilot region and will misbehave elsewhere.
# Review notes: heuristic service runs unprivileged; it reads weights
# read-only from the tuning store and writes nothing back.
# Only one sensitive value exists in this file: the tuning-store access
# credential, consumed at boot and never logged.
# That credential is set on the following line.

secret setting of faduf-bahop: LEDGER_TOKEN8=c3b363be

**Ticket: Staging env misconfigured — currency rounding drift**

Plugin authors reported half-cent discrepancies in Tillmark conversions. Root cause: staging used the truncating rate feed instead of the banker's-rounding feed. Set `RATE_FEED_MODE=bankers` and redeploy. The corrected feed also requires authentication against the Ostervale rates service, so the credential line must follow directly after this one.

sealed setting: RELAY_SECRET5=82864

## Formula sandbox tuning

User-supplied formulas in Gridmoor execute inside a restricted interpreter with hard ceilings on time, memory, and call depth. Reviewers should confirm any change to these ceilings is justified in the PR description, since raising them widens the abuse surface. Defaults were chosen from production traces. The current limits are as follows.

limits module of tafog-fawip:
WEIGHTS = {
    "julix": 57,
    "lamys": 992,
    "kasvan": 209,
    "quenok": 750,
    "alddor": 259,
    "oliath": 1009,
    "wenix": 815,
}